Budget Advisory Committee
Dear Burbank Unified School District Community,
As part of our continued commitment to fiscal responsibility, and collaborative problem‑solving, I am pleased to share an important update regarding the formation of the Budget Advisory Committee (BAC).
Last month, we invited education partners, community members, staff, and students to apply to serve on this new advisory group. The goal of the BAC is to strengthen community engagement in our budgeting process, deepen understanding of our fiscal systems, and ensure that future financial decisions reflect the values and needs of the entire BUSD community.
Today, we are proud to announce the committee members who have been selected to serve.
